About RGA Reinsurance Group of America Incorporated

Reinsurance Group of America Inc is an insurance holding company with operations in the United States, Latin America, Canada, Europe, Africa, Asia, and Australia. The core products and services include life reinsurance, living benefits reinsurance, group reinsurance, health reinsurance, financial solutions, facultative underwriting, and product development. The company's operations are divided into traditional and financial solution businesses.

About DVA DaVita Inc.

DaVita is one of the largest providers of dialysis services in the United States, boasting a market share of about 35%. The firm operates over 3,200 facilities worldwide, mostly in the US, and treats about 300,000 patients annually. Government payers dominate US dialysis reimbursement. DaVita receives about two-thirds of US sales at government (primarily Medicare) reimbursement rates, with the remainder coming from commercial insurers. While commercial insurers represent only about 10% of US patients treated, they represent nearly all of the profits generated by DaVita in the US dialysis business.
